*FOMC STATEMENT:*
- The Fed raised rates by 25 bps to 3.75%–4.00%.
- The vote was 12–0. No dissents.
- Inflation is still too high.
- The Fed says this hike will bring inflation back to 2% faster.
- The economy is growing at a solid pace and spending has held up.
- Hiring is keeping up and unemployment has barely moved.
- Productivity and business investment are strong.
- The Fed says it will deliver price stability.
Overall tone: Hawkish.
